1 | 31-01-25 | Battling Blues |
The Journal Club presentation was held on 31st January 2025, at the Seminar Hall, on the topic “Battling Blue”. The resource person, Ms. Raheena K.A., delivered a comprehensive presentation on the topic, covering aspects such as,the sources of blue light emission (digital devices, LED lighting, etc.),the effects of blue light on the human eye and sleep patterns, Strategies for reducing exposure to blue light (blue light filtering glasses, apps, etc.). The presentation was followed by a lively discussion, where participants shared their experiences and insights on the topic. The meeting concluded with a formal ceremony, where Dr. Dilip C, Principal, issued a certificate of appreciation to the resource person, Ms. Raheena K.A., in recognition of her informative and engaging presentation. The Journal Club meeting provided a valuable platform for knowledge sharing and discussion, and we look forward to future events. |

14 | 22/02/2023 |
Careful |
On February 23, 2023, Al Shifa College of Pharmacy hosted a Journal Club presentation by Neethu Varghese, Associate Professor in Pharmaceutical Chemistry, titled “CARE FULL.” Addressing challenges faced by seniors living alone, Mrs Neethu highlighted the transformative impact of smart home devices and healthcare technologies. The discussion covered solutions like PILL PEZ for accurate medication dispensing, Bluetooth trackers for belongings, fall detectors, CAM My Eye for the visually impaired, DEXCOM CGM for real-time glucose monitoring, and LIBERTY LIFT for assisted mobility. Attendees actively engaged in discussions, recognizing the potential of these innovations to enhance seniors’ safety, independence, and overall well-being. The session underscored the College’s commitment to holistic education and community welfare. |
